Transaction 3d2528b3dcad611efb6bf4f129d5f73cebd2dee77b9e72bdedc386b47921156d

1 Input
2 Outputs
  • 3d2528b3dcad611efb6bf4f129d5f73cebd2dee77b9e72bdedc386b47921156d:0
  • value  15811320
    address  1AfKM7Dw8Yqi1SBJTAw74sSrheUJskLVLM
  • 3d2528b3dcad611efb6bf4f129d5f73cebd2dee77b9e72bdedc386b47921156d:1
  • value  12330099
    address  1EZf8B12sriMHnePCos2bHcA6DrX2pz4tC